What is a Remote Invoice Data Entry job?

A Remote Invoice Data Entry job involves entering and managing invoice information into digital systems or databases from a remote location, such as your home. Workers in this role review invoices for accuracy, input billing details, and may also help reconcile discrepancies or communicate with vendors and clients. The position typically requires attention to detail, organizational skills, and familiarity with accounting or data entry software. Remote invoice data entry jobs are popular for their flexibility and the ability to work from anywhere with an internet connection.

What is the difference between Remote Invoice Data Entry vs Remote Accounts Payable Clerk?

AspectRemote Invoice Data EntryRemote Accounts Payable Clerk
CredentialsBasic data entry skills, familiarity with invoicing softwareAdditional accounting knowledge, possibly some certification in bookkeeping
Work EnvironmentPrimarily computer-based, focused on data inputComputer-based, may involve communication with vendors and finance teams
Industry UsageCommon in finance, administrative, and accounting sectorsUsed in finance, accounting, and corporate finance departments
Search & Comparison IntentLooking for entry-level invoicing rolesSeeking roles with broader accounting responsibilities

Remote Invoice Data Entry involves inputting invoice information into systems, requiring basic data skills. Remote Accounts Payable Clerk handles invoice processing along with additional accounting tasks, often needing more financial knowledge. Both roles are computer-based and common in finance sectors, but the Accounts Payable Clerk role typically involves broader responsibilities and some accounting expertise.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Remote Invoice Data Entry specialist,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Remote Invoice Data Entry specialist, strong attention to detail, fast and accurate typing skills, and basic financial knowledge are essential, often supported by a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with accounting software such as QuickBooks, Microsoft Excel, and online invoicing platforms is typically required. Organizational skills, time management, and the ability to work independently are standout soft skills in this role. These skills and qualities ensure data accuracy, timely invoice processing, and efficient remote workflow management.

What are some common challenges faced in a remote invoice data entry role, and how can they be managed?

Remote invoice data entry professionals often face challenges such as maintaining accuracy with large volumes of data, managing time effectively without direct supervision, and ensuring data security when handling sensitive financial information. To overcome these, it’s important to develop strong attention to detail, use productivity tools to track tasks and deadlines, and follow company protocols for secure access and storage of documents. Regular communication with team members and supervisors also helps ensure alignment and quickly resolve any discrepancies.

What Financial Systems contributes to Cardinal Health

Finance oversees the accounting, tax, financial plans and policies of the organization, establishes and maintains fiscal controls, prepares and interprets financial reports, oversees financial systems and safeguards the organization's assets.

Financial Systems oversees the design, modification, installation and maintenance of accounting and financial systems and digital tools to ensure the accuracy of financial transactions.

Financial Systems is responsible for overseeing the design implementation, modification, installation and maintenance of accounting and finance systems to ensure the accurate recognition of financial transactions. Ensures data integrity, manages system interfaces, completes the chart of accounts, maintains access/controls, owns the financial data warehouse application and creates report building mechanisms and interfaces with IT. Revise controls for new or modified computer applications to prevent inaccurate information. Oversight and project ownership of SAP ECC, SAP S4, and other financial systems.
